Reporting to the Red-D-Arc President, the incumbent is responsible for leading the sales, operations, and distribution, as well as the human capital resource planning and strategy development for their Region.


Essential Functions

  • Ensures each branch within the region is visited on a quarterly basis.
  • Conduct Business reviews with Regional Operations Managers, District Managers, and Branch Managers within the region to assess current and upcoming projects, equipment / building standards, inventory issues, open rental agreements, credit issues, and the overall Customer Experience
  • Participate in annual sales meetings and quarterly business reviews.
  • Be involved in the talent acquisition process and personally interview anyone being considered for a management or sales position.
  • Conduct scheduled performance reviews and annual wage reviews of direct reports.
  • If required, assist regional sales managers with annual reviews of region sales staff.
  • Work with District Managers and Regional Operations Managers to plan strategies & training programs to improve sales skills of inside staff.
  • Oversees internal & external training for the Regional organization and teams in support of Company Initiatives and local development needs.
  • Plans, prepares and manages annual operating budget for their region.
  • Review monthly P&L and question DM and ROM on any substantial variances (positive as well as negative)to allow for discovering the answers
  • Approve customer credits and branch expenditures over Region Operations Manager’s approval authority limits.
  • Reviews and approves all wage increases for their region.
  • Researches and targets new locations for future branch / satellite / consignment for future growth, including potential acquisition targets.
  • Expand present boundaries and develop new markets aligned with Company growth strategies
  • Develop and execute an annual sales growth plan. Implement specific product line growth strategies to grow regional volumes year-over-year.
  • Participate in annual business review with Airgas senior management.
  • Plan and participate in RVP & Regional Sales Manager meetings, possibly as a prelude to our exec meetings in quarters as necessary.
  • Each RVP will have some additional “corporate” responsibilities as assigned
  • Work on personal goals set by the Red-D-Arc President.
  • Maintains a safe working environment by following Airgas Safecor and Red-D-Arc specific health and safety guidelines.
  • Performs other related duties as required.
